    The Mines and Geosciences Bureau (MGB) is a government agency of the Philippines under the Department of Environment and Natural Resources (DENR). The MGB is responsible for the conservation, management, development, and use of the country's mineral resources, including those in reservations and public lands. [3]

    Barreto conducted several morphological and geological research within the expanse of the Philippines. [10] Barretto began working as a geologist and geophysicist for GNS Science in 2013. [5] [6] Barretto led an in-depth research project on Benham Rise in 2015. Her team included Ray Wood from GNS Science and John Milsom from Gladestry Associates.

    A geologist is a scientist who studies the structure, composition, and history of Earth. Geologists incorporate techniques from physics , chemistry , biology , mathematics , and geography to perform research in the field and the laboratory .

    Article 99 of the Labor Code of the Philippines stipulates that an employer may go over but never below minimum wage. Paying below the minimum wage is illegal. [10] The Regional Tripartite Wages and Productivity Boards is the body that sets the amount for the minimum wage. In the Philippines, the minimum wage of a worker depends on where he works.
